Two militants killed in Budgam encounter

Srinagar: Two militants have been in a gunfight  between militants and government forces in Zugoo Arizal area of Central Kashmir’s Budgam district on Thursday.

The operation was jointly conducted by  army’s 53RR, SOG and CRPF.

They had laid a siege around Zugoo, Arizal over  inputs about presence of some militants in the area.

SSP Budgam Tajinder Singh confirmed that two militants have been killed while their identity is still being ascertained.
